This paper looks closely at the aesthetics of the bodies and landscapes in Monica Hughes' Invitation to the Game and M.T. Anderson's Feed – the flesh, the wires, and the pixels – to consider the complicated relationship between the often “unadulterated” beautiful and the “threatening” grotesque in these (and other) science fiction narratives that involve the hybridisation of the artificial and the organic. |
